Players who cast this card win 21% of the time (n=81) , vs 27% when it never left the library (n=813).

When players drew this card but left it in hand, they won 32% (n=108).

Read this as correlation, not as the card's contribution. Casting a card means you lived long enough to cast it, so this gap widens with mana value across every card we track.

Observed gap -5.2pp; 95% confidence interval -10.9pp to +0.4pp. Correlational, not causal: powerful payoffs also get cast more often in games you are already winning.

How is Playgroup Live card data collected?
Players using Playgroup Live import their decklists before a game and log card actions as they play. Each cast, zone change, and resolution is recorded as a real game event. Stats on this site are computed from those events, not from decklist scrapes or theorycrafting. Playgroup has recorded 690,000+ Commander games overall, and this card-level play data comes from the Playgroup Live subset of that corpus.
